There are only three basic steps to be taken when multiplying monomials. However it is assumed that your child is comfortable with the basic structure of monomials, and that they have already mastered the skill of adding and subtracting monomials.
So before continuing be sure they are familiar with the language that will be used here. Your child must also be both familiar and comfortable with both the commutative and associative properties of arithmetic.

As you can see, when it comes to multiplying monomials it is simply a case of applying the laws of arithmetic you already know and applying the laws of exponents.
